IP networks provide us with untold flexibility, but this flexibility presents us with interesting challenges of control. Developments in SDN (software defined networks) are leading the way through the separation of the control and data plane. And as we discover more of what SDN means, we soon realize that broadcasters are closer than they may think in achieving its operation.

This Core Insight answers the questions of what it means to control an IP network, how we achieve it, and why. By comparison to existing SDI and AES systems we present an intuitive understanding of IP routing and demonstrate the flexibility IP networks offer.
